> Perhaps we should
>
> 1. Not ship with EDITOR/PAGER set to anything by default (well written old
> standalone programs should then default to vi and more, or get a bug
> report).
This is already the case. See section 10.9
> 2. Always honor EDITOR/PAGER if they are set.
This is already the case. See section 12.4
> 3. Make sure GNOME programs can be set up to launch a different editor
> than $EDITOR/$PAGER with user intervention.
> This approach translate as "if I don't know whats going on, give me the
> upstream author's default, otherwise, give me my favorite editor unless
> I've already specified that it doesn't work well for this application".
Could you expend how 1 2 3 above implement that?
Anyway, I disagree with this approach. The correct approach is 'if I
don't know whats going on, give me a consistant default i.e. always the
same for a given configuration, not a default that change for each
launcher programs.'
